November 13: Sina Sports has signed a strategic partnership deal with Great Sports, a subsidiary of Shanghai Media Group (SMG), which will see the two sides seek opportunities to cooperate in various sports platforms, event establishment and capital partnerships.
The signing ceremony was attended by sports celebrities from sports media companies and representatives from the CBA, Tencent Sports, Super Sports and Yutang Sports.
Sina Sports is the sports division of the Chinese news outlet Sina, while its partner Great Sports is a Shanghai-based media channel specializing in delivering sports content, event productions and promotions.
“Shanghai, where Great Sports has made a huge presence, is a very important market for the Chinese sports industry.” Sina Sports General Manager Arthur Wei said, “the 19-year-old Sina Sports wants to create a partnership model for traditional TV broadcasters and new media platforms.”
Great Sports General Manager Weng Weimin also remarked, “Both of us are outstanding media platforms who have great histories and experiences. Facing the changes in the sports landscape, we need to become good ‘product managers’, keeping pace with the demands of the public.”
